Getting Data In: 4 Ways to Ingest Data into Splunk

The first step to unlocking the power of Splunk is to get access to your data. No matter what data type or structure it is, Splunk can read it. Watch this video to learn about the four main ways to get your data into Splunk. Including, securely sending lossless data streams by installing the Universal Forwarder on your Linux or Windows host, easily ingesting cloud data sources (e.g., AWS, Azure, and GCP) via Guided Data Onboarding, creating data inputs for virtually any TCP or UDP data traffic, and using the HTTP Event Collector (HEC) to ingest web and app data.
